anyone know this moped?

Hello all,
I just bought this moped / scooter but for the life of me cannot find service information on it. Is anyone familiar with it? Is there a generic 50cc moped service manual out there or am I just not a good internet searcher? This is what I have:
2007 PGO Big Max-50
Engine ID: P2 H28550
engine family: 7GSCC.049PGO

Made by: Motive Power Industry Co. Ltd. Taiwan
It is a 2 stroke, has an oil pump and looks to have a slide carb. This is our first scooter so I would like to know how to service it...heck, I don't even know if it is belt drive or not.....
Can anyone point me in a direction?...
OH, on a side note, went to get a headlight bulb for it today (there was no bulb in there).....everything I could find said 12v 35/35w. Well I got one but there is no way it fits...too big. Any short answers there?

Here is a place to start looking:
Twist and Go (automatic transmission) Chinese, Taiwanese and Korean Scooters Haynes Repair Manual for 50cc to 200cc engines
I am not sure if it covers everything or just the tranny.
